# Break-Glass Access — Cachewell Postmortem Tooling

Following the Cachewell stale-cache incident, plugin authors who need read access to the postmortem replay environment may use the break-glass flow. This is audited, time-limited, and intended only when the Delvane approval queue is down. The replay gateway will request the recovery passphrase, which is maintained immediately below.

vault phrase of bagaf-kajeg = jorath-feniel-briir-siliel-ralix

Ticket: Staging env misconfigured for Siftgate bloom filter

The bloom layer in front of the Pellet KV store is rejecting all lookups in staging because the env file was copied from the dev template without credentials. False-positive tuning values are fine; only the auth line is missing. To unblock the weekly demo, the Pellet admission secret must be set on the following line.

env line for yaguf-fajop: LEDGER_TOKEN13=fb08984397349

## Deployment: Soft deletes on orders

This release enables soft deletes on the `orders` table in Quillbasket's order service. Deleted rows are now flagged rather than removed, with a scheduled purge job handling permanent cleanup after the retention window. Deploy requires running migration 047 before rolling the app tier; downgrade is safe but re-exposes flagged rows. The relevant service configuration, as it will ship, is as follows.

settings of fajop-fahap:
[holeth]
port = 9300
team = juleth
host = holeth.tolvaqsoft.example
region = south-4
access_code = ac_4bcdf6
timeout_ms = 500

**Ticket: Deep links to saved recipes open the home tab instead**

On Fernwheel's mobile app, links of the form /recipes/{slug} resolve correctly on cold start but fall back to the home tab when the app is already foregrounded. The router seems to drop the path segment during warm resume, likely in the intent parser added in the Maplewick release. Reproduces on both platforms, roughly 60% of attempts. Please verify against the staging router before paging the apps team. The affected build is identified below.

build token for kagaf-hahof: htk14_9d3d4d26d7d8de